Transaction 66182a1099e10599814bfdc468420e5ac3498b1d3060b94853fbf7c4aee87f76
2 Input
2 Outputs
- 66182a1099e10599814bfdc468420e5ac3498b1d3060b94853fbf7c4aee87f76:0
- 66182a1099e10599814bfdc468420e5ac3498b1d3060b94853fbf7c4aee87f76:1
value 36230000
address 12MeXFVdygDU4fwRuSd2Y26x5u4K9P3Gkf
value 17972048
address 1KumbRsTcA6UNqU2MHEfqEFnAZYU3w3izR